Matricia Bauer's traditional name is Isko-achitaw waciy / ᐃᐢᑯ ᐃᐦᒋᑕ ᐘᒋᕀ, which translates to "she who moves mountains." She is a tour guide, singer, drummer, speaker and artist who has shared her culture in hundreds of schools across Alberta, Canada. She has also lectured at several domestic and international conferences.
